MySQL cookbook fails on Ubuntu Lucid 10.04

The mysql::server recipe doesn’t work on 10.04. I cloned from the
cookbook repository and encountered errors.

WARN: Missing gem ‘mysql’
INFO: Installing gem_package[mysql] version 2.8.1 ruby x86-mingw32
x86-mswin32
/usr/local/lib/ruby/gems/1.8/gems/chef-0.8.16/bin/…/lib/chef/mixin/command.rb:181:in
`handle_command_failures’: gem install mysql -q --no-rdoc --no-ri -v
"2.8.1 ruby x86-mingw32 x86-mswin32" returned 1, expected 0
(Chef::Exceptions::Exec)

$ sudo gem install mysql -q --no-rdoc --no-ri -v "2.8.1 ruby x86-mingw32
x86-mswin32"
ERROR: While executing gem … (ArgumentError)
Illformed requirement [“2.8.1 ruby x86-mingw32 x86-mswin32”]

Manually installing the mysql gem uncovers another error.
$ sudo gem install mysql

INFO: Backing up template[/etc/mysql/grants.sql] to
/etc/mysql/grants.sql.chef-20100515233421
[Sat, 15 May 2010 23:34:21 -0600] ERROR: ruby_block[save node data]
(/home/vbox/share_vbox/chef-solo/cookbooks/mysql/recipes/server.rb line
88) had an error:
undefined method closed?' for nil:NilClass /usr/local/lib/ruby/1.8/net/http.rb:1060:inrequest’
/usr/local/lib/ruby/gems/1.8/gems/chef-0.8.16/bin/…/lib/chef/rest/rest_request.rb:58:in
`call’

Is the MySQL cookbook working on 10.04 for anyone?

This is actually an issue with RubyGems 1.3.7. They changed the output
formatting of gem list, which Chef uses to determine what Gem versions
are available from the remote server to install.

I have tested that the mysql cookbook works on Ubuntu 10.04 with:

    • Ruby and Ruby1.8 from Ubuntu packages
    • RubygGems:
    • 1.3.6 installed from source
    • 1.3.5 installed from package
    • Chef 0.8.16 installed from RubyGems or Packages

Hi there,
I reopened CHEF-1168. The problem is that MySQL has different versions
available for different architectures:

mysql (2.8.1 ruby x86-mingw32 x86-mswin32, 2.7.3 mswin32)

The gems I looked at when originally solving this issue only have one
version for all architectures, for example:

nokogiri (1.4.1 ruby java x86-mingw32 x86-mswin32)

We'll have to redo the fix to take the multiple version by
architecture case into account.
